The London 2012 Olympic Torch Relay has now begun its momentous 70-day, 8,000 mile journey around the UK prior to the start of the Games on 27 July.


On Friday 22 June, we will welcome the Mother Flame to Wyre.

This will be a massive event for the area and in order to make it as memorable as possible, we are urging people to line the streets and cheer on the torchbearers as they pass through no less than four of our towns and villages.

To get you into the spirit of things, Wyre Council has organised a packed programme of events that will take place in each town (see below for details).
